User's notes

A large eucalypt, not like any others seen nearby, bark varies from very smooth to very rough with no particular pattern or sequencing to where each texture is located on the trunk. Light green leaves (photo 5). A Land for Wildlife assessment commented it was something special but I cannot see any linkable reference to this tree’s identity in the assay document.
